Ant control services involve professional treatment methods designed to eliminate and prevent ant infestations in residential and commercial properties. These services typically include thorough inspections to identify the type of ants and the extent of the problem, followed by targeted treatments that may involve baiting, trapping, or applying insecticides in specific areas. The goal is to reduce ant activity quickly and effectively, while also implementing preventative measures to keep ants from returning. Many service providers tailor their approach based on the property’s layout and the severity of the infestation, ensuring that homeowners receive a customized solution suited to their specific needs.
Ant problems often arise when ants find accessible food, water, or shelter within a property. Common signs of an infestation include visible ant trails, nests near foundation walls, or the presence of ants inside kitchens and pantries. These pests can pose health concerns by contaminating food or surfaces, and their presence can also cause property damage, especially if they establish nests in hidden areas. What types of ants do ant control services target? Ant control services typically address common household ants such as carpenter ants, odorous house ants, and pavement ants, among others.
How do local contractors eliminate ant infestations? They use a combination of baiting, trapping, and treatment methods tailored to the specific ant species and infestation severity.
Are ant control treatments safe for pets and children? Many service providers use treatments designed to minimize risks, but it's best to discuss safety concerns with the local contractor handling the job.
Will ant control services prevent future infestations? While treatments can reduce current populations, ongoing prevention measures may be recommended by local experts to help keep ants from returning.
What should I do before a local contractor provides ant control service? It's generally advised to keep areas clean, remove food sources, and follow any specific instructions provided by the service provider to ensure effective treatment.
